 - Biographical notes
 - Author of the only known translation of Faḍl Allāh Astarābadī’s ʿArshnāmah. He was possibly a disciple of Faḍl Allāh Astarābadī himself. He may have been from the region of Shushtar.

 - Notes
 - A free translation of Faḍl Allāh AstarābadīʿArshnāmah, also in mes̱nevī form. It was composed only twenty seven years after Faḍl Allāh Astarābadī’s execution. It consists of 2511 couplets.
